Sanju Samson was omitted from the T20I squad for the series against Zimbabwe despite having won the player of the tournament in India's T20 World Cup win. Samson's omission has sparked reactions from fans online, with an old Gautam Gambhir tweet also going viral, where the now India coach had expressed his surprise at Samson's exclusion from the T20I team.
An old tweet by former India cricketer and current head coach Gautam Gambhir has gone viral after Sanju Samson was left out of India's T20I squad for the upcoming three-match series against Zimbabwe. The post, made years before Gambhir took charge of the national team, has resurfaced amid renewed debate over Samson's exclusion.
"It's weird that the only playing eleven Sanju Samson doesn't find a place is that of India, rest almost everyone is ready for him with open arms," Gambhir had tweeted on September 22, 2020.
Gambhir, then was a commentator and cricket analyst, who was in awe after Samson had stroked a magnificent 74 off just 32 balls against CSK.
It has now become a talking point following Samson's latest omission from the national side. Fans have widely shared the tweet across social media, questioning the wicketkeeper-batter's absence.
